What Are OEM Brake Discs?

OEM stands for Original Equipment Manufacturer, which means that these brake discs are made to meet the specifications set by the vehicle manufacturer. Opting for an OEM brake disc ensures compatibility and performance akin to what was originally designed for your vehicle.

Benefits of Choosing OEM Brake Discs

  1. Quality Assurance: OEM brake discs are produced to the strict standards of vehicle manufacturers.
  2. Perfect Fit: They are designed specifically for your vehicle’s make and model, ensuring optimal performance.
  3. Reliability: OEM parts have been tested for durability, reducing the likelihood of premature wear or failure.
  4. Warranty Protection: OEM parts often come with warranty guarantees, providing additional peace of mind.

Comparing OEM Brake Discs to Aftermarket Options

OEM Brake Discs

FeatureDescription
QualityBuilt to specific OEM standards
FitExact fit for specific vehicles
WarrantyUsually includes a longer warranty period
PerformanceTested for reliability in vehicle specifications

Aftermarket Brake Discs

FeatureDescription
QualityVaries between manufacturers and can be inconsistent
FitMay not fit as precisely as OEM parts
WarrantyTypically shorter warranty periods
PerformanceMay offer varied performance; requires careful selection
